Overview:Ant and Dec welcome back eight more acts as they compete in the last of the semi-finals. The acts try to wow the judges and the public to secure their place in the final.
Watch Trailer
First Air Date: Jun 09, 2007Last Air date: May 31, 2025Season: 18 SeasonEpisode: 290 EpisodeRuntime: 60:14 minutesQuality: HDIMDb: 5.582 / 10 by 73 usersPopularity: 10.0089Language: en
Comment